WHAT IS COUNTDOWN TO MILLIONS?
Countdown to Millions is a multi-million dollar raffle-style game with the best odds of winning $1 million. Tickets are on-sale for a limited time.
IS IT A SCRATCH-OFF GAME?
No, Countdown to Millions is an online terminal game that is generated like a Pick 3/Pick 4 ticket.
WHEN IS THE DRAWING?
The drawing will be held on 07-07-07 (July 7, 2007), “The Luckiest Day of the Century.”
IS THIS THE FIRST COUNTDOWN TO MILLIONS GAME?
No, the first Countdown to Millions game was introduced in November 2006. That drawing was held on January 1, 2007.
HOW MUCH DOES EACH TICKET COST?
Tickets cost $20 each.
HOW MANY TICKETS ARE AVAILABLE?
There are only 420,000 tickets available and once they are all gone – they are gone!
WHAT HAPPENS IF THE GAME DOES NOT SELL OUT?
The drawing will still take place on July 7, 2007.
WHAT ARE THE PRIZES?
There will be four $1 million prizes and over 900 prizes between $500 and $50,000.
ARE THERE ANY SPECIAL PROMOTIONS WITH THIS GAME?
Beginning June 18th, players will receive a $2 Quick Pick Mega Millions ticket (for the next Mega Millions drawing) every time they purchase a Countdown to Millions ticket.
Previously, there was a bonus coupon promotion associated with the game. Players received a bonus coupon with an 8-digit number. Four bonus coupon numbers were randomly drawn every day for $500 each! Winning numbers can be found on the Lottery’s website.
HOW IS THE DRAWING CONDUCTED?
The drawing is conducted using a Random Number Generator (RNG). An RNG is a highly secure computerized system that selects numbers randomly. The Lottery has used an RNG for many years to conduct coupon drawings, including the following: Countdown to Millions, Pick 3 Bonus Match-Up, Pick 3 30th Anniversary Promotion and Catch the Poodles.
As with all Lottery drawings, Officials must adhere to strict drawing procedures to ensure the integrity of each drawing. The drawing is witnessed by a Drawings Manager, a Security Official, an Internal Auditor, and an Information Technology Representative. For added security, the drawing is video-taped.
